    The statewide assessment program is designed to provide parents, teachers, policy makers, and the general public with information regarding how well students are learning South Carolina’s academic standards.  It is very important that students are prepared to do their personal best.  Below are ways you can help during the testing period.

    Before the Test
    Please schedule doctor/dental appointments around test dates so that students are present and on time for tests each day.

    On Test Days
    Make sure your child gets a good night's sleep and eats a healthy breakfast.  This will ensure that your child is working at full capacity.

    If your son or daughter wears glasses, make sure they have them.

    Remain positive and help students avoid conflicts or becoming upset. Help your child stay calm. If students get upset about anything before school, they are likely to experience anxiety during the test.

    Arrive on time.

    Thank you for supporting your student and encouraging him or her to do his or her best during this test administration.

    Message from the School Nurse

    FROM THE RICE CREEK HEALTH ROOM…………
    PARENTS/GUARDIANS:
    We have had an incredible amount of visits to the health room so far this year. This is where the school nurse needs your help to talk with your children about what are appropriate health room visits. The school nurse is responsible for seeing that the students are healthy. The health room personnel also provide basic first aid and can communicate with you if your child becomes ill or seriously injured at school. Reminders about the health room:
    •         Health room personnel provide basic first aid for incidents that occur during school hours.
    •          Our health room does not keep stock medication such as Tylenol or cough drops. If your child needs a prescription medication, a medication permission form must be signed by the doctor and the medication brought to the health room in its original package with label. Medications should not be sent on the bus. Over-the-c0unter medications can be sent in the original package with a medication permission form filled out by the parent/guardian, or a note brought in with the medication stating the name of the medication, how much to give, what time or how often child is allowed to have the medication. Again, medications should not be sent on the bus and it is always best to have a parent/guardian bring medication directly to health room. All medications must be locked in the health room.
    •          OUR HEALTH ROOM SERVICES ARE NOT A REPLACEMENT FOR GOOD MEDICAL CARE FROM YOUR FAMILY HEALTH CARE PROVIDER. Our health room personnel may be able to assist you in obtaining a provider if you do not have one.

    Thank you all for your cooperation and for taking time to speak with your children. If you have any questions regarding your child’s health, please do not hesitate to contact the school nurse!
